The cement mill,Cement clinker is usually ground using a ball mill. This is essentially a large rotating drum containing grinding media normally steel balls. As the drum rotates, the motion of the balls crushes the clinker. The drum rotates approximately once every couple of seconds. 8.3.2.2 Ball mills. The ball mill is a tumbling mill that uses steel balls as the grinding media. The length of the cylindrical shell is usually 1–1.5 times the shell diameter ( Figure 8.11). Cement Milling Understanding Cement
Cement Milling. Cement milling is usually carried out using ball mills with two or more separate chambers containing different sizes of grinding media (steel balls). Grinding clinker requires a lot of energy.
